Focusing on community involvement, this book emphasizes the importance of transforming the behavior of individuals sentenced to correctional work without incarceration. It outlines a methodology for community mobilization aimed at facilitating the reintegration of these individuals, thereby reducing recidivism and enhancing the effectiveness of their sentences. The work highlights the need for improved community work methodologies, particularly in a contemporary context where local solutions are prioritized politically, socially, and economically.
